Hello, and greetings to all. I was recently diagnosed with autism late last year, as well as growing up with a documented learning disability. My interests include baking, driving (long, calm drives with no destination in mind...and all day to get there) as well as playing music, writing in my journal(s), learning more about autism, and spending time with my fiancee.

I've read two acclaimed books on autism--Unmasking Autism[i][/i] and 'But you Don't look Autistic by both Devon Price and Bianca Toeps.

I'm considering writing/publishing a memoir as well, but...perhaps it's a work-in-progress.
